I get excited every time someone asks about the cast of 'Outlander' because the show is basically a rotating repertory theatre — some actors are anchors, others come in for whole arcs or single unforgettable episodes. Across all seasons the absolute constants are Caitríona Balfe as Claire and Sam Heughan as Jamie; they anchor every major season and almost every episode. Early seasons (1–3) lean heavily on the Highland ensemble and 18th-century players: Tobias Menzies shows up in the dual role of Frank Randall and Jonathan 'Black Jack' Randall during the show's early three seasons, Graham McTavish and Duncan Lacroix are big presences in the clan storylines, and Lotte Verbeek and Nell Hudson appear as important recurring figures. Season 2’s France arc brought in actors like Romann Berrux as young Fergus (who later grows into César Domboy’s version of Fergus), and Andrew Gower as Prince Charles.

From season 3 onward the cast shifts to include the next generation — Sophie Skelton as Brianna and Richard Rankin as Roger become series regulars once time-skip plotlines bring the 20th-century thread back into play. David Berry’s Lord John Grey recurs across several seasons, too. There are also many guest performers who dominate single episodes: battle epics, trial episodes, or France-set court scenes often have dozens of credited guest stars and local extras. The show also recasts and ages characters (that Fergus recast is one of the more visible examples), so the actor list for an individual character can change between seasons.

If you want per-episode credits, the quickest way is to look at episode pages on IMDb or the official episode guides on Wikipedia and the show's streaming platform — every episode lists principal and guest cast. ¡Vaya viaje que es 'Outlander'! Si tuviera que resumir quiénes aparecen en cada temporada, lo hago pensando en los nombres que siempre vuelven y en los fichajes que cambian el tono de cada tramo. En todas las temporadas verás a Caitríona Balfe como Claire Fraser y a Sam Heughan como Jamie Fraser —ellos son el eje desde la 1 hasta la 7—. En la temporada 1 además destacan Tobias Menzies en los papeles duales de Frank Randall y Black Jack Randall, Graham McTavish como Dougal MacKenzie, Gary Lewis como Colum MacKenzie, Lotte Verbeek como Geillis Duncan y Duncan Lacroix como Murtagh; ese primer bloque es muy de clanes y Highlands. La temporada 2 mantiene a Claire y Jamie y suma mucho material de la corte en Francia, con rostros recurrentes y nuevos secundarios que empujan la trama política; Tobias Menzies sigue muy presente aquí. A partir de la temporada 3 se amplía el universo temporal: aparecen de forma destacada Sophie Skelton como Brianna y Richard Rankin como Roger, y se consolidan personajes como Ed Speleers en el papel de Stephen Bonnet (villano que vuelve en varias temporadas). En las temporadas intermedias y tardías (4, 5 y 6) la serie se traslada a Norteamérica y entran/recuperan actores como Maria Doyle Kennedy (Jocasta), David Berry (Lord John Grey) y varios secundarios que van marcando los arcos americanos; Murtagh (Duncan Lacroix) reaparece en momentos clave. La temporada 7 sigue con la base Claire–Jamie–Brianna–Roger y mezcla regresos de personajes anteriores con caras nuevas propias del arco americano. Si quieres la lista exhaustiva por capítulo o todos los actores episódicos, suelo mirar la ficha de cada temporada en la página de la producción o en bases como IMDb/Wikipedia —allí verás cada crédito episodio por episodio—, pero a nivel general esos son los núcleos que marcan cada temporada. I get a little giddy just listing this lineup because Season 1 of 'Outlander' packs so many strong faces into that first trip through time. At the center are Caitríona Balfe as Claire Beauchamp (later Claire Fraser) and Sam Heughan as Jamie Fraser — their chemistry pretty much anchors the whole show. Tobias Menzies pulls double duty as Frank Randall (Claire’s 1940s husband) and the terrifying Black Jack Randall in the 18th-century storyline. Around them you’ve got the MacKenzie clan: Graham McTavish as Dougal MacKenzie, Gary Lewis as Colum MacKenzie (the clan chief), and Duncan Lacroix as Murtagh Fraser, Jamie’s loyal godfather. Lotte Verbeek brings a chillingly mysterious edge to Geillis Duncan. There are also a few memorable younger and supporting players who flesh out the Highlands and 1940s scenes — names like John Bell (Young Ian) show up, and multiple guest actors rotate through village and English social circles. Because the show is adapting Diana Gabaldon’s 'Outlander' novels, many characters feel rich on-screen right away.
